I Did It My Way

Yes ,my essence turned into lit passion, as I tenderly brushed my doubts at night to hold unto truth and slay my dragons; a gang war between bold cliques, so contrite. When I rejected the Junior league’s pleading my batch-mates scorned, hissed at me with disgrace; alone, they ousted me from our circle’s ring that losing dear friends tore my peaceful space. Yet, in conscience, self’s boundaries I kept Till smiles pealed to rise above youth’s trial, And the old pack beckoned, gaining its respect To learn that fury was one bitter gall.
